Keyword Marine pollution Pollution control Monitoring Freshwater pollution Recreational water use Geographical area Asia, Europe, Europe and Central Asia, European Union Countries, Mediterranean, Middle East, Western Asia Abstract This Law implements Directive 2006/7/EC as regards the management of bathing water quality. It sets forth the parameters and standards to be used for carrying out bathing water quality assessments. Competent authority for the application of the law shall be the Environmental Service under the Ministry of Agriculture, Natural Resources and Environment. The monitoring and follow-up of quality of waters shall be upon the Sanitary Services of the Department of Medical and Public Health Services and the General Chemical Laboratory of the Ministry of Health.
